Born in Moscow in 1976, she began painting in 1989, taking private lessons in coloristic painting in the studio of artist Mikhail Markovich Babenkov. In 1994, she entered the Moscow Textile University, specializing in fabric art. Since 2025, she has been a member of the National Pastellists' Society of Russia. Since 2019, she has been actively involved in illustration, having illustrated nine books. She currently lives and works in Moscow. Primary areas: landscape, animal painting, and still life.
"Feelings and impressions are important to me. Often, it's not the object itself that matters, but the impression and mood it leaves. The same applies to color. I'm a follower of the coloristic school of painting; it's important to me to find the harmony of a unique state and convey character.
When choosing projects for illustration, the most important thing for me is to convey the hero's feelings, not only through a portrait of the hero, but using all means - composition, rhythm, textures, the character of lines, shadow and light."
